“China-European Art Dialogue”: a journey into Chinese art at Palazzo Coppini

On October 21 2024, Palazzo Coppini hosted a unique event: the traveling exhibition “China-European Art Dialogue: Chinese Painting Special Exhibition,” which brought Chinese art to Europe through the 24th delegation of the Chinese Academy of Painting and Calligraphy Culture. Curated by Alan Yu and Feihong Yu, the exhibition offered a fascinating insight into Chinese painting and calligraphy, featuring a selection of 20 paintings and 2 sculptures.

Each artwork told a unique story, representing various aspects of Chinese daily life. From traditions to festivals, from moments of work to those of leisure, the pieces painted a rich and vivid picture of Chinese culture. Among the exhibited works, two portraits of Paolo Del Bianco, Honorary President of the Romualdo Del Bianco Foundation, were also included, testifying to the strong bond between cultures that the event aimed to celebrate.

The exhibition was not just an opportunity to admire art, but it also played a crucial role in strengthening cultural dialogue between Asia and Europe. This event recalled a previous meeting between Alan Yu and the Florentine audience in 2016 at the l’Auditorium al Duomo, when an exhibition was held featuring the painter Mr. Nie Weigu.

Another significant moment of the event was the donation of paintings to the Romualdo Del Bianco Foundation, a gesture that underlined the artists’ and delegation’s commitment to supporting cultural and social projects. The donation made the event even more special, serving as a bridge between different cultures and further strengthening the connection between East and West.
